Rosemary Ayorkor Acquaye was born April 19, 1954 in Accra, Ghana to the late Okoe Laryea and Madam Kate Laryea. Along with her brother, Adjei Okoe Laryea, and sisters, Cecilia Okoe Laryea and Grce Okoe Laryea, Rosemary was raised in Accra, where she attended the Government Girls School, Adonte Secondary School and the Commercial School. After moving to Oklahoma she attended Vo-Tech in Muskogee and earned her C.N.A. She was employed at the Wagoner Walmart for the past eighteen years. Rosemary departed this life on April 16, 2013 in Wagoner, Oklahoma, just three days before her 59th birthday. Rosemary and her husband, Aaron's, marriage of twenty-six years was blessed with two children. Rosemary loved people so much that, when you didn't speak to her, she would ask if there was a problem. She was a kind and generous woman, and she always created laughter around her. One of her favorite scripture verses is in the book of Psalm 91:1: He that dwelleth in the Secret place of the most high shall abide under the shadow of the Almighty. The family will be present for a Visitation from 5-7 p.m. Friday at Mallett Funeral Home in Wagoner. The Funeral Service will be at 12 p.m. Saturday, April 27, 2013 at Mallett Funeral Home Chapel. Interment will follow in Pioneer Cemetery in Wagoner.
